Port St. Lucie is located along Florida’s Treasure Coast between Orlando and Miami. Port St. Lucie offers easy access to I-95, Florida’s Turnpike, pristine beaches, championship golf, and the iconic St. Lucie River.
The Facilities Maintenance Division provides comprehensive maintenance, repair, and operational oversight for all City-owned buildings and infrastructure. The new Facilities Maintenance Director will report to the City Manager or designee.
The ideal candidate will be an experienced facilities management professional with deep knowledge of building systems, maintenance operations, sustainability, and construction project oversight.
Required qualifications include:
Bachelor’s degree in civil engineering, mechanical engineering, or a closely related field
Ten (10) years of progressively responsible facilities management experience
At least three (3) years supervising middle-management staff
Valid Florida driver’s license with a clean driving record
Preferred qualifications include:
Experience in local government facilities management
Advanced experience in capital projects or construction oversight
Familiarity with CMMS systems and sustainability frameworks
Additional relevant certifications (e.g., facilities engineering, project management)
Master’s degree in a related field
LEED AP O+M or comparable industry certification
Starting salary range $135,607.68 – $155,948.83 DOE/DOQ. Full salary range extends to $210,191.80.
